Frequently Asked Questions

What is the FHA upfront mortgage insurance premium (MIP) for a home in Crockett County, TX?

FHA loans require an upfront MIP of 1.75% of the base loan amount, typically financed into the loan. For homes in Crockett County, TX, the exact amount depends on your purchase price and down payment.

How much is the monthly FHA mortgage insurance in Crockett County, TX?

FHA loans require an annual MIP of approximately 0.55% of the loan balance per year for most 30-year loans in Crockett County, TX, paid monthly as part of the mortgage payment.

Does FHA mortgage insurance go away in Crockett County, TX?

Unlike conventional PMI — which automatically cancels at 80% LTV under the Homeowners Protection Act — FHA annual MIP on loans with less than 10% down does not fall off. For FHA buyers in Crockett County, TX putting 3.5% down, this means ongoing monthly MIP payments of approximately several hundred dollars for the life of the loan. To eliminate MIP, borrowers must refinance into a conventional loan once they reach 20% equity, or put 10%+ down at origination (MIP then cancels after 11 years).
